A double-cavity traction-drive CVT (continuously variable power transmission) for four-wheel-driveline has potential to provide a new type of four-wheel torque-distributing transmission without a center-differential gear unit. This paper describes its principle and bench-test result by making a CVT with speed-ratio-range from 0.345 to 2.9, input torque capacity of 250 Nm and rotational speed of 5500 rpm. The principle is to control the front and rear torque by controlling the front- and rear-speed-ratio of each CVT unit. Their ratios are settled by measuring the front- and rear-axle torques. As to bench-test, dynamic characteristics of torque distribution at torque change is examined.
